Architecture of Observation Towers

It seems to be human nature to enjoy a view, getting the higher ground and taking in our surroundings has become a significant aspect of architecture across the world. Observation towers which allow visitors to climb and observe their surroundings, provide a chance to take in the beauty of the land while at the same time adding something unique and impressive to the landscape.

Replacement-Doors-300x200.jpgDoors that are sagging

Sagging doors can have a negative impact on the appearance and functionality of your home. It can cause gaps and making it difficult to open and close doors, and even cause structural damage. There are many methods to restore the functionality and appearance of doors that are sagging. The first step is tightening loose hinge screws. This usually is enough to resolve the problem However, if it isn't you could try adding shims to correct the alignment of the door in the frame.

Then, look at the door frame. If the hinges are rusty and are not strong enough to support the weight of your door. You can remove the rusty hinges and replace them with new ones to restore their strength and capacity to support the weight of your door. It's also a good idea to use longer screws since they provide the best anchor point and prevent future sagging.

A sagging door can be caused by many things, including a shifting base or changes in humidity. It is essential to take care of the issue immediately, no matter how small or huge it is. It can become worse over time, leading to drafts, energy loss and even structural damage.

A worn-out or obsolete set of hinges is one of the most frequent causes of sliding. Older hinges are unable to support the weight of a heavy door and will wear out over time. This is especially true if the hinges have been exposed to elements such as rain or snow. Installing new hinges can fix this issue. They are durable and designed to last.

Another common cause of sagging is that the latch mechanism has fallen and is no longer aligned with the strike plate. You can fix this by either dropping the strike plate or by putting a shim on the bottom of the door. If you lower the strike plate you'll need to chisel parts of the jamb away and you could end up causing damage to the screwholes. You won't need to worry about damaging the strike plate or jamb if you use a shim.

Doors that don't shut properly

Bifold doors are a standard feature of many homes in the UK. They can be used both internally for partitioning, or externally to create a more spacious space and connect it to an outdoor living area or summer house. They can also be used to increase the security of a home. However, like any door they are susceptible to being damaged in time. This can be due to many factors, such as wear and tear or extreme climate conditions. In some cases it can cause the door to be out of alignment or even break. Thankfully, this is usually an easy problem to solve.

Examine the track for obstructions and debris in the event that your bifold door is not closing correctly. Sometimes dust and dirt can be trapped between the tracks, which can cause the door to stop closing or create a noise when opened. It's also a good idea to grease the hinges and rollers to stop this from happening in the future.

If your bifold doors make an eerie sound when they are opened it is likely there is something lodged in the tracks or the door mechanism itself. This is a very common issue with the doors and is often fixed by taking out the object. You can also lubricate your tracks to see if that can help.

This can also be caused by the strike or latch plate not being aligned with latch holes in the door frame. This could be due to a loose or worn hinge or a shift in the door frame, or the floor or threshold. Try tightening the hinge screws, or using larger screws to align the door. You should find that it works better.

Lastly, it's worth remembering that pets, children and accidents can all put a lot of pressure on your doors, or cause them to move. This could cause the doors to break or become damaged, resulting in them not closing correctly. You can sand or hammer old screw holes that were created in the door frame and then apply wood filler to match the color.

Doors that are stuck

If you have bifold doors that seem to be getting stuck, it's important to know what's going on. Most often, it's because the system isn't working properly. There are a few things you could try before calling an expert, and you must ensure that the bi fold door repair frame is set properly. This is especially crucial for commercial bifolding doors, which need to work reliably and easily.

Glass-Replacement-150x150.jpgBifold doors are incredibly versatile and can make huge spaces feel more spacious and open. They can be employed for any purpose, whether you want to connect living spaces or create a dining space or open up a small kitchen. They are also utilized in commercial spaces to make restaurants and shops more inviting and appealing to customers. They also increase the amount of light that enters the space.

Bifold doors are usually lighter (some are louvered, and others are hollow-core) and they're installed with a top pin that inserts into the bracket. The brackets typically have several setting points, so you can adjust the height of the door and move it either up or down. You can also adjust them by loosening the screws and moving them to the left or the right. But it is not recommended to force the door into a position since this could cause damage to the frame or the lock.

Sometimes, the issue is that the runners or track are blocked by dirt or other debris. Grit is often the cause, and cleaning the tracks can easily fix this problem. You can use a cleaner that is suitable for household fixtures and fittings but be cautious not to use any product that is too strong, as it may damage the door seals.

Another issue with bifold doors is that the lock isn't engaging. This is a major issue because it could leave your door open to anyone who is able to operate it. This could be a major security risk. It's important to address the issue as quickly as you can.

Doors that fall off the track

Bifold doors are a great method of connecting outdoor and indoor spaces. They're extremely adaptable and offer a continuous circulation of light and air. They're ideal for kitchens and living areas which open up to balconies or gardens as well as dressing rooms and walk-in wardrobes.

They usually consist of a series of panels that slide along runners that run across the floor and the upper lintel, or beam of the doorway. They are available in a variety of materials like aluminium, timber, upvc and. The glazed panels can be strengthened or toughened to provide greater security. This is important for bifolding doors with external openings that are exposed to the elements.

If they're installed inside or outside bifold doors need little maintenance once they're fully operational. Regularly cleaning their frames and glass will keep them looking like new. Lubrication may also assist them in moving effortlessly and stop them from sagging.

There are some things, however, that could cause your bifold doors to be more susceptible to falling off the track. The biggest culprit is deterioration of the rollers, which allow for the smooth up and down motion of the doors. If they aren't lubricated properly, or if the rollers fail completely, they can cause the doors to fall off the track.

It could be hazardous, especially if you open and close the door frequently. Make sure that the rollers are in good shape. The most frequent issue is worn out hardware, specifically the hinges and bottom rollers. They may freeze in place, or they may start to wobble and fall off completely.

It's also possible for locks to break, which could be a major issue in the event that the door is used frequently and frequently. This can be due to pressure that is too high or aging. To stop this from occurring it is advisable to have your locks checked regularly. These services are inexpensive and will save you from expensive repairs that are required for broken locks.
